Page 2: Sloan2007

Background• National Guard

• PDA

• Army: 100% portability

• deliver distance college courses w/o connectivity

• same academic rigor

• motivating & engaging learner experience

Training Trainer Method Timeline Cost Learning Outcomes

ID for self-directed and paced content & instruction

Sebastian Foti Workshop, Elluminate, and Moodle

TBD [complete by Dec 29th]

TBD [500.00] By the end of this training, participants will be able to:

• Apply research-based motivational techniques in course development, learning activities, and assessment • Apply motivation research & best practices to media

development• Acquire best practices based on learning and motivation

research to promote effective instructional practices in a distributed and untethered distance course delivery model.

iMovie Apple & FCCJ Staff

Workshop, Elluminate, and Moodle

TBD [complete by Dec 29th]

None • Become proficient at creating instructional media using iMovie

Garage Band Pod-casting Apple & FCCJ Staff

Workshop, Elluminate, and Moodle

TBD [complete by Dec 29th]

None • Become proficient at creating instructional media using Garage band

Applying Motivational Research to Create Optimum Learning Environments

Bill Ganza Online Asynchronous through Blackboard

Nov 12-Dec 30th

None By the end of this training, participants will be able to:

• Identify the factors that make up what we call motivation • Define motivation and its related components • Explore motivation theory through a real-life case example • Identify the research trends regarding motivation research • Identify the major theoretical approaches to the study of

motivation • Apply the research in various fields such as education,

business, and marketing • Design self-regulatory strategies that will aid learners in

developing self-motivation

LMS Demonstrated Competency or prior training [BlackBoard]

Staff FCCU Online Asynchronous through Blackboard

None By the end of this workshop, participants will be able to:

• use common Blackboard features to: post an online syllabus and assignments; interact via discussion board; develop quizzes; and manage grade books; • use the tools to enhance interactivity such as teams and

collaboration • understand the experience of a course management system

from both the student and instructor perspective; • convert existing content for display in Blackboard • use the communication and course management tools

Page 12: Sloan2007

challenges for faculty

• short time frame

• new course concept

• distributed team

• required moderate media skills

• required excellent team skills

• experienced with DL

12

Page 13: Sloan2007

lessons learned year one...

• focus on instructional quality

• speaking skills essential

• tighter design guides

• auditions via YouTube

• media heavy courses

• utilize cross-departmental QA process/team
